以下为基于“eos tp钱包”相关主题的系统性分析框架与专业建议报告。为便于落地,本文将围绕:可扩展性架构、密码管理、高效交易确认、全球化技术创新、全球化数字趋势进行拆解,并给出可执行的改进方向与衡量指标。
一、可扩展性架构(Scalability Architecture)
1)分层架构建议
- 客户端层:钱包端负责密钥派生、地址管理、交易构造、签名与本地状态缓存。避免将链上查询与签名耦合过深。
- 同步/路由层:对接EOS网络或聚合服务(RPC/Index/Relayer)。建议采用“请求归一化 + 自适应路由”机制,减少因网络差异导致的兼容成本。
- 交易与状态层:对交易广播、重试、回执拉取、失败原因解析进行状态机管理,形成可观测链路。
2)性能瓶颈与容量设计
- 吞吐:关注签名计算与交易序列化开销。对常见交易类型(转账、授权、合约调用)建立缓存与模板化构造流程。
- 延迟:减少往返次数(如先本地构造与预验签,再广播;对回执采用指数退避轮询/订阅)。
- 可用性:RPC多源并行或故障切换(failover)策略:主用+备用+降级模式。
3)可扩展指标(建议)
- TPS支持:在目标并发签名/广播量下的稳定表现。
- 成功回执率:在给定超时窗口内的回执获取成功率。
- 交易失败可解释性:失败码统计与归因准确率。
二、密码管理(Cryptography & Key Management)
1)威胁模型
- 本地设备风险:恶意软件、Root/越狱、屏幕录制、剪贴板泄露。
- 网络风险:中间人攻击、重放/篡改广播请求。
- 用户风险:助记词泄露、重复导入、钓鱼签名。
2)分级密钥策略
- 助记词/主密钥:仅在安全环境中解密或派生;避免明文长期驻留内存。
- 派生密钥:按账户/用途/路径分离(例如按链网络、应用场景区分派生路径),降低“单点泄露导致全资产可用”的风险。
3)签名与防篡改
- 本地签名:尽量做到交易内容与签名过程在本地完成。
- 签名前校验:对gas/资源上限、收款方、memo、合约参数进行语义校验,提示用户关键字段。
- 交易域分离(Domain Separation):确保签名上下文绑定链ID/网络标识,避免跨链重放。
4)备份与恢复
- 助记词导出机制必须强化:二次确认、遮罩显示、风险提示、可选硬件/安全模块(如存在)集成。
- 恢复流程要避免“导入即自动签名授权”这类高风险默认行为,建议增加授权检查与冷却策略。
5)合规与审计建议
- 记录最小必要的安全日志:如操作类型、失败原因、版本号;避免记录私钥相关数据。
- 定期安全评估:包含依赖库漏洞扫描、加密实现审计与渗透测试。
三、高效交易确认(Efficient Transaction Confirmation)
1)确认流程拆解
- 广播阶段:向多个节点发送或选择最优节点,避免单点延迟。
- 进入链上:通过get transaction / push receipt 等接口判断是否入块。
- 最终性:结合EOS的块确认/不可逆性或等效策略(以链的实际参数为准),将“被打包/不可逆确认”区分呈现。
2)状态机与重试策略
- 状态机建议:构造中 -> 签名完成 -> 已广播 -> 收到回执/入块 -> 最终确认 -> 失败/重试中。
- 重试:对可重试错误(网络超时、临时拥塞)进行指数退避;对确定性失败(权限不足、授权缺失、参数无效)及时停止并给出修复建议。
3)减少轮询开销
- 订阅/推送优先:若条件允许使用WebSocket/事件订阅。
- 批量查询:对多笔交易采用批量回执查询,减少RPC调用成本。
4)用户体验(UX)建议
- 透明提示:显示“已广播/已入块/最终确认”三个层级,避免用户误判。
- 失败可恢复:提供失败原因+自动重建建议(例如重新拉取最新nonce/参考块信息后再签名)。
四、全球化技术创新(Globalized Technical Innovation)
1)多地区网络与合规差异
- 节点与路由:构建地理就近的节点访问策略,降低跨洲延迟。
- 合规与数据最小化:在面向不同地区时,明确数据采集范围(例如分析埋点不含敏感信息)。

2)工程创新方向
- 轻量化与离线能力:提升弱网场景下的离线交易构造与签名体验。
- 自动化安全更新:快速修复依赖漏洞;对用户端提供渐进式更新与回滚机制。
3)互操作生态

- 与主流交易基础设施兼容:支持不同RPC提供商、不同索引器格式(通过适配层实现)。
- 标准化消息/交易解析:统一交易字段解释,提升跨合约/跨应用的一致性。
五、全球化数字趋势(Global Digital Trends)
1)趋势判断
- 多链与跨境用户增长:用户会更关注“跨链资产安全与确认速度”。
- 隐私与安全升级:用户对签名透明度、钓鱼防护、最小权限授权更敏感。
- 移动端与低端设备普及:需要低耗资源的密码与交易构造优化。
2)产品与运营联动建议
- 安全教育内嵌:在关键授权与签名前增加“风险识别”提示。
- 多语言与本地化:不仅是界面翻译,更要包括交易字段解释的文化/术语准确性。
- 指标驱动迭代:以“确认时延、失败率、可解释性、留存与投诉率”作为持续优化依据。
六、专业建议报告(可执行清单与衡量指标)
1)优先级P0(短期,1-4周)
- 建立交易状态机与统一回执/错误归因体系。
- 提供“入块/最终确认”分层展示。
- 强化签名前的语义校验与字段告知(收款方、memo、合约、授权范围)。
2)优先级P1(中期,1-3个月)
- 引入多节点路由与故障切换,优化广播与回执拉取链路。
- 完善分级密钥派生与内存安全策略(减少明文驻留)。
- 引入风险拦截:钓鱼签名检测、重复授权检测、最小权限建议。
3)优先级P2(长期,3-6个月及以上)
- 探索订阅式确认与更高效的事件驱动架构。
- 与更多基础设施适配,强化跨地区稳定性。
- 进行系统化安全审计与持续监控(安全日志最小化+告警机制)。
4)建议的量化指标(示例)
- 平均确认时间(入块与最终确认分别统计)。
- 失败交易的纠错成功率(重试后成功率)。
- 安全相关事件统计:钓鱼拦截命中率、风险提示点击转化率。
- 稳定性:RPC故障切换成功率、平均超时率。
结语
综合来看,EOS TP钱包要实现“可扩展性 + 密码管理稳健 + 高效交易确认”,关键不在单点优化,而在架构层面的解耦、状态机治理与安全策略体系化。通过多节点路由、确认分层、签名前语义校验以及分级密钥管理,可以显著提升用户体验与安全韧性;再结合全球化路由与本地化表达,便于在全球数字趋势中形成长期竞争力。
(注:本文为通用架构与安全建议思路,具体实现细节需结合目标EOS网络参数、TP钱包现状与合规要求进一步落地验证。)
评论
Minghao
架构拆成客户端/路由/交易状态层很清晰,状态机治理会显著提升可观测性与故障恢复能力。
AliceW
密码管理部分强调分级密钥与域分离,这点对防重放和降低单点泄露风险很关键。
小雨点
高效确认建议把“入块”和“最终确认”分开展示,能减少用户误判和客服压力。
KaiTheCoder
全球化路由+就近节点对延迟改善很直接,但也要配合失败归因,不然体验提升会被误导。
ZhengWei
我喜欢你把量化指标也给出来了,比如失败交易纠错成功率,比只谈性能更可落地。